what is the slope of the line 5x - 2y = -10? a. negative five halves b. five halves c. two fifths d. negative two fifths e. none of the above

5x-2y=-10
Making y the subject of the formula;
5x+10=2y
2y=5x+10
y=[tex] \frac{5}{2} x+5[/tex]
The slope is 2.5 or five halves
